Nettet13. nov. 2024 · Good day! I apologize that you are having this issue and I am hoping we can work through it and fix it. PRess windows key + R > type "devmgmt.msc". Scroll to Mice and right click your mouse > properties > power management > Allow this device to wake the computer. Patience is a virtue. 7 people found this reply helpful. Nettet17. feb. 2024 · Click Change advanced power settings. Double-click on Sleep, then set Allow hybrid sleep in Off and set Allow wake timers to Enable. Click Apply > OK. Restart your computer, test on your machine again and see if it wakes up without fail.
